When videos from a mysterious brand called ‘HUVrTech’ were first dropped in March 2014,  showing a ‘working hoverboard’ being ridden around by names such as Tony Hawk, the social media world went into overdrive. The board could ride over any surface, had the ability to perform amazing tricks and could reach quite impressive speeds. While it was hardly a surprise that the ‘HUVrTech Hoverboard’ turned out to be a hoax orchestrated by the guys at FunnyorDie, the video set off the imaginations and determination of many to turn this dream into a reality.

When working prototypes were made by brands such as Lexus, the capabilities and restrictions of them just didn’t fulfil the original hype from the HUVrTech board. However, to coincide with the 30th anniversary of the Back to the Future trilogy, an ‘official commercial’ has been made for the iconic hoverboard that appears in the films. While the hoverboard in this video is obviously not the real deal, the commercial is worth a suss – especially since October 21st 2015 is the date Marty McFly and Doctor Emmett Brown will reach us, according to the second instalment of the Back to the Future trilogy.
